====================================================================== From the HSLDA E-lert Service... ====================================================================== April 11, 2005 North Carolina--DNPE to Stay Under Department of Administration Dear HSLDA members and friends: To follow up with our E-lert to you of April 4, 2005, I am pleased to report that the Governor's Office has withdrawn its proposal to relocate the Division of Non-Public Education (DNPE) from the Department of Administration to the Department of Public Instruction (DPI). On Wednesday, April 6, 2005, representatives from North Carolinians for Home Education, the North Carolina Christian Schools Association, the North Carolina Association of Independent Schools, Secretary of Administration Gwynn Swinson, DNPE Director Rod Helder, General Counsel Brooks Skinner from the Department of Administration, and Dan Gerlach from the Governor's Office met to discuss concerns raised by this proposal. Mr. Gerlach explained that the proposal to transfer DNPE from the Department of Administration to DPI was a budget-driven, not a policy-driven, proposal. He stated that the idea for the transfer was generated by the need to locate funds to employ more people within DNPE to meet the new administrative responsibilities it now has, such as the driving eligibility certificate program introduced in 1998. There has also been a substantial increase in the number of homeschools in North Carolina from 8,171 for the 1995-96 school year to 28,746 for the 2003-04 school year. Finally, Mr. Gerlach announced that the Governor's Office will inform legislators that the proposal to shift DNPE to DPI is no longer part of the budget proposal and is not an appropriate solution to the manpower problem being experienced within DNPE.
